Hear from members of the RCC Sexual Violence Resource Center’s GameChangers, a collective of young activists who are passionate about social justice and creating change in their communities. GameChangers focus on educating themselves and their communities about sexual violence and intersecting oppressions through projects. Recently, they have hosted rallies, coordinated art shows, and informed school administrations of what students need. In this panel, they will share their perspectives on social justice and experiences as activists. Learn more about youth activism and what matters most to youth right now!
